MITSUBISHI <CONTROL / DRIVER IC>
M51970L
MOTOR SPEED CONTROL
DESCRIPTION
The M51970L is a semiconductor integrated circuit designed to
control the motor rotating speed.
Connection of the rotating speed detector (F-G detector) to the
input keeps the motor rotating speed constant with high precision.
Connection of an appropriate power transistor to the output
controls a wide range of DC motors.
FEATURES
qWide range of supply voltage • • • • • • • • • • • • • 2.5 – 18V (-20 – +75˚C)
qVariation coefficient of supply voltage
• • • • • • • • • • • ±0.1% standard (4 – 15V)
qLoad variation coefficient • • • • • • • • • • • • • • • • • • • • • • • • • • ±0.1% standard
qTemperature coefficient of rotating speed
• • • • • • • • • • • • • • ±10 ppm/˚C (standard)
(-20 – +75˚C)
qThe built-in over-shoot prevention circuit keeps the over-shoot
low.
qDC drive system with minimum RFI
APPLICATION
Motor rotating control in the player, tape recorder, etc.
RECOMMENDED OPERATING CONDITIONS
Supply voltage range •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• 2.5 – 18V
Rated supply voltage •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• • 9V
